Block cuts to New York libraries – Telemundo New York (47)

NEW YORK – A final-minute deal at Metropolis Corridor will stop main cuts to New York Metropolis’s libraries and return all three public library techniques to seven-day-a-week operations, officers introduced.

After months of protests and public outcry, information broke Thursday of an settlement to finish a proposal to chop much more tens of millions from town finances and crippled libraries.

In response to a joint assertion from the president of the Metropolis Council and the mayor’s workplace, an settlement was reached to revive greater than $58 million for libraries within the 2025 finances.

“Council has constantly advocated for restoring funding to those establishments as a high precedence, and we’re proud to succeed in an settlement with Mayor Adams and the administration to make these essential investments.” safe them within the metropolis finances. ” President Adrienne Adams mentioned in a press release.

The deliberate cuts have been anticipated to strengthen libraries, whose budgets had already been lower final yr, which means they might lose Sunday work. Now, due to the newest settlement, steady providers are anticipated to be maintained and libraries will open on Sundays.

The Adams administration’s proposal to chop tens of millions extra from the finances was instantly met. Occasional protests have been held throughout town for months, with among the loudest criticism coming from the libraries themselves.

It has the NYPL account

It’s reported that town’s finances might be voted on subsequent week, simply in time to fulfill the June 30 deadline.

The joint assertion from President Adams and Mayor Eric Adams additionally promised that one other $53 million might be returned to cultural establishments via the Group of Cultural Establishments and Cultural Growth Fund beneficiaries.
